
Modifications to the LP570-4 Superleggera are aimed at placing a Gallardo onto public roads that closely resembles the Blancpain Super Trofeo racers we see on track. There’s a new larger spoiler and an engine lid that optimizes ventilation; Skorpius wheels with yellow-painted brake calipers and discs made from carbon-ceramic composites are also featured.
Carbon fiber has been used to make external components such as the diffuser and mirror casings. The exterior receives a matte black finish to complement these touches.
The entire interior has been finished in black Alcantara with yellow accents and visible carbon fiber. Plenty of Blancpain logos symbolise the special nature of this vehicle both inside and out. The engine is the same as the serial Superleggera featuring 570bhp.
Dry weight is just 1340 kilograms (2954lb) making this the lightest road going model that Lamborghini produce!
